Overview

Thomas Bird is a Neurologist in Seattle, Washington. Dr. Bird is highly rated in 18 conditions, according to our data. His top areas of expertise are Dementia, Huntington Disease, Drug Induced Dyskinesia, and Alzheimer's Disease.

His clinical research consists of co-authoring 131 peer reviewed articles and participating in 1 clinical trial.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years.
